Supreme Court Decision on Late-Arriving Mail-In Ballots Grants Relief to 18 States

Monday, June 29, 2026


The Supreme Court ruled on Monday that state laws allowing ballots to arrive after Election Day are legal. The decision addressed whether states have the authority to set their own deadlines for mail-in ballot receipt. Eighteen states had laws permitting ballots to be counted if they arrived after Election Day, provided they were postmarked by Election Day or met other specified criteria.
